Official: Free-Scoring Lacazette Joins Nigerian Strikers At Arsenal For Club-Record Fee
FA Cup kings Arsenal have finally announced the signing of France international Alexandre Lacazette from Lyon on undisclosed terms.
Media reports in England suggest that the Gunners parted with £52 million, a club record, to capture the signature of the 26-year-old, who reportedly put pen to paper on a five-year contract.
The transfer fee beat the previous record (£42.5 million) set by Mesut Ozil when he joined the club from Real Madrid in 2013.
Lacazette is expected to be included in Arsenal's traveling party to Australia and is likely to make his home debut in the Emirates Cup on July 29 or July 30.
The striker was on the books of Lyon for fourteen years and netted 91 league goals for the club over the past four seasons.
Hale End Academy products Alex Iwobi and Chuba Akpom play for the first team of Arsenal.
